Never Saw Her Alive by Demola Adeleke (See_demmy)

 
"More water please pleaseeeee!" I screamed as I felt another round of agonizing pain warring against my eye balls. As if they were pricked with a sewing needle, the pain rose violently like the sun trying to dry up the red sea in less than a second as Tunde sprinkled the water on my face and blew both air
 and spit into my eyes with one of his thumbs holding my left eye-lid. "Wait wait" I yelled as I remembered how he lost his incisors to a fight with one of the agberos who beat him black and blue for philandering with Saki; the popular fish monger in the next street whom had earlier accepted the conductor's proposal before Tunde's intrusion, "you are just spitting ni jorh" I said angrily.
The pain gradually subsided and I was as relieved as a lamb who suddenly got to know that the big lion gazing fiercely at it was only a statue. I gently opened my eyes and closed it back, then opened it again to be sure of what I noticed was true...
As if the rainbow was descending on a thousand of prisms, the whole sitting room was filled with colours; red, green, yellow, and blue were the only familiar ones while others seemed new to me, except from the black wall clock which happened to share the same colour with the world I've lived for over 8 years now.
I began to look around like there was a voice calling my name at every angle of the massive living room. "what's wrong!" Tunde asked in a trembling voice," is it your walking stick?" he inquired again as he noticed I was about to take a pace forward..."I can see!!! Tunde! I can now see!!" My voice immediately sounded louder than a karaoke "I can see your upper jaw without 2 teeth" we both screamed aloud which caught the gate-keeper's attention and afterwards, he joined us and the 3 of us rejoiced for the restoration of my damaged sight... "God is indeed wonderful", said Tunde "he only fell from the stairs and his eyes were corrected" he replied John's question on how it all happened...
At this time, all I wanted to see was Ronke, the only friend who stood by my side during my encounter with the dark world. Mum and dad wouldn't return until the following day and for my sister, she has gone back to school and only comes home during the semester break. "Ronke deserves to be seen first" I convinced my thought. "It's either 53 or 54" I soliloquized as I tried to remember the number of her house at about 7 streets away from ours.
"I'm gonna make her my girlfriend today" I kept talking to myself but Tunde couldn't hear me since the car stereo was at a very high volume and his mind was completely at Wizkid's latest single recently released the previous day which he was listening to...
I had promised him 5,000 naira if he agreed to take me to Ronke's house and without the slightest hestitation, he accepted since it's a secret that will never be revealed to either mum or dad...
We drove along the road and passed through my primary school and was so happy to see that tall building where I spent my first 6 years at school and also the same place I met "Aderonke" my trusted friend who borrowed me some strength to fight depression when my life was in total shambles...
"Please help us! Please! Please!" there was a hullabaloo at the road side. It seemed like a fresh accident just occurred and people were gathered at the side of the road so as to help the victims to the hospital, all they needed was a car that would bring them to the hospital and because of this, they waved at all passing vehicles and ours wasn't an exception.
Tunde trod on the clutch and the car slowed down, "do you want to stop or what?" I asked him as I noticed he was about to apply the brake, he nodded, signifying that he wanted to stop the car so he could help bring the victims to the hospital. "And what about the Ronke's house that we are going?" I asked, "if you stop for this people, then forget the 5,000 that I promised you" I vowed.
He quickly complied with my wish and trod on the accelerator... The people who had already had their hopes raised that a car had finally stopped shouted while some cried bitterly to see us run away. We eventually got to Ronke's house and got down from the car. We were about knocking on their gate when her parents rushed out of the house, entered the car, and drove off.
I approached one of the people that was outside the house to know what has happened and there, we were told that they just received a call that their Ronke had a very terrible accident. "Where!! Where did it happenned???" I immediately forgot the rules of grammar..."beside Total filling station" the lady replied, Jesus! That can't be! The same spot we were stopped earlier!....
Tunde and I got into the car and rushed back to where the victims were lying but ............
I NEVER SAW HER WITH MY EYES ALIVE!
